Output 3454835b233f53fc7752a1787f67f387cbaed424a85cd89ab812d96b7c8faf65:1

value
124172
script pubkey
OP_0 OP_PUSHBYTES_20 edf380760ce27f03534178b7094b5a96f0d56f39
address
bc1qahecqasvuflsx56p0zmsjj66jmcd2mee07g3gw
transaction
3454835b233f53fc7752a1787f67f387cbaed424a85cd89ab812d96b7c8faf65
confirmations
58235
spent
true